GemGenève: A World-Class Jewelry Showcase

GemGenève was created by industry insiders for industry insiders. It brings together antique jewelry dealers, contemporary designers, gemologists, collectors, and manufacturers. Known for its strong curatorial vision and high standards, GemGenève celebrates excellence in craftsmanship, heritage, and innovation. It has become a must-attend event in the global jewelry calendar, offering a refined alternative to traditional commercial fairs.
